Elementary Concepts of Spiritism is no substitute for the main works of the Spiritist Codification. It’s a quick and simple guide for those curious to learn Spiritist fundamentals: God, the immortality of the soul, Spirit communication, mediumship, the plurality of worlds and Jesus. It includes a succinct account of the story of Spiritism, a Q & A chapter, and a collection of maxims conveying the main points contained in the Spiritist Codification.
